    Property Grade 1 Grade 2 Grade 3
    Minimum Yield Strength 30,000 psi (207 MPa) 35,000 psi (241 MPa) 45,000 psi (310 MPa)
    Minimum Tensile Strength 50,000 psi (345 MPa) 60,000 psi (415 MPa) 66,000 psi (455 MPa)
    Minimum Elongation (2-inch gauge) 18% 14% 20%

    Manufacturing Process vs. Size Capabilities
    Process Max OD (mm) Max WT (mm) Length Range (m) Cost Efficiency Best For
    SSAW (Spiral) 3200 30 6-18 Highest Large diameter, medium wall thickness (16"-48")
    LSAW (JCOE) 1422 50 6-15 High Ultra-thick wall (≥1.0"), high strength requirements
    ERW 660 25 6-12 Medium Small to medium diameter, standard wall thickness
    Seamless 1016 100 6-12 Lowest Critical applications, corrosive environments

    1. What is the ASTM A252 Grade 3 steel pipe piles?
    ASTM A252 grade 3 steel pipe piles are welded structural steel pipes for application as deep foundation support under buildings, bridges, ports, and offshore engineering. There are two welding processes for these pipes: helical submerged arc welding pipe (SSAW) or the longitudinal submerged arc welding pipe (LSAW/EFW).
